There are 2 owner-reported air bags & restraints complaints for the 2022 Jeep Wagoneerin NHTSA's database. These are unverified consumer reports and may not reflect confirmed defects.
3rd row seat belt is fraying/cut. Appears to be from the mechanism in the roof of the car. Jeep is refusing to replace it. And trying to charge 1500 dollars for the repair. It is a major safety concern as if someone was in that seat and were involved in a car accident the seatbelt would not work properly
I hit a deer head on then a tree directly after head on at around 35mph and the air bags did not deploy
